Description
The Insulin like growth factor-1, also known as Somatomedin-C is a growth factor which is structurally related to insulin and is an important regulator of growth and differentiation in various tissues and cell systems. Human IGF-1 is synthesized as two precursor isoforms with N- and alternate C-terminal propeptide. The two precursor isoforms are differentially expressed by various tissues. The proteolytic cleavage of the N- and C-terminal regions results in the mature IGF-1 protein which is identical between isoforms. IGF-1 binds to IGF-1 receptor and induces receptor autophosphorylation. This further phosphorylates Insulin receptor substrate -1 (IRS-1) and activates various downstream signaling pathways including the PI3-AKT, MAPK etc. (PMID: 17354613, 17113337, 29535161)
